Kelebihan dan Kekurangan pada Python
• Pemrograman berorientasi obyek
• Interaktif, dinamis, dan alamiah
• Akses hingga informasi interpreter
• Tidak ada deklarasi tipe sehingga program lebih
sederhana, singkat, dan fleksibel
• Python tidak dapat digunakan sebagai dasar bahasa
pemrograman implementasi untuk beberapa komponen
• Python memberikan efisiensi dan fleksibilitas tradeoff by
dengan tidak secara menyeluruh
Persamaan Python dan Ruby
• Ada Ruby Interaktif (irb)
• Dapat membaca dokumentasi di command line
• Tidak ada karakter khusus untuk akhir baris program
• Buka kurung dan tutup kurung siku untuk list, serta buka
dan tutup kurung kurawal untuk hash
• Array merupakan fungsionalitas yang sama. Menambah array
menghasilkan array gabungan. Memasukkan array ke dalam array lain menghasilkan
array bersarang.
Perbedaan Python dan Ruby
• Isi string dapat diubah
• Dapat membuat konstanta
• Ada public, private, dan protected untuk mengatur hak
akses keinstance member yang biasanya di Python menggunakan penamaan _ seperti
__.
• Ruby menggunakan true, false dan nil. Sedangkan Python
menggunakan true, false, dan none
• Menggunakan elsif sebagai ganti elif
• Ekstensi penyimpanan program untuk Python dengan .py
sedangkan untuk Ruby adalah .rb
Sumber : PERBANDINGAN ANTARA PYTHON DAN RUBY
Tidak ada komentar:
Posting Komentar